According to records kept by The Financial Industry Regulatory Authority (FINRA) financial Broker Troy Thomas (Thomas), currently associated with Mcdermott Investment Services, LLC, has at least one disclosable event. These events include one customer complaint, alleging that Thomas recommended unsuitable investments in different investment products including debt securities among other allegations and complaints.

FINRA BrokerCheck shows a settled customer complaint on January 17, 2023.

[REDACTED] allege that the firm failed to conduct adequate due diligence in connection with [REDACTED]’s 2015 investment into four Delaware Statutory Trusts purchased to effect a tax-advantaged 1031 exchange of [REDACTED]’s prior real estate investments. [REDACTED] also allege that these investments were unsuitable. Allegations also include breach of fiduciary duty, negligence, common law fraud, and failure to supervise.

According to records kept by The Financial Industry Regulatory Authority (FINRA) financial Broker Debra Schleining (Schleining), currently associated with Mcdermott Investment Services, LLC, has at least one disclosable event. These events include one customer complaint, alleging that Schleining recommended unsuitable investments in different investment products including debt securities among other allegations and complaints.

FINRA BrokerCheck shows a pending customer complaint with a damage request of $1,580,000.00 on February 07, 2025.

Claimant, an experienced real estate investor, purchased a Delaware Statutory Trust in 2015 as part of a tax-advantaged 1031 exchange of Claimant’s prior real estate investment. The DST is still viable and performing according to the offering documents, but not to Claimant’s satisfaction. Accordingly, Claimant has made various allegations and legal claims related to unsuitability of the investments and inadequate due diligence. Allegations also include breach of fiduciary duty, negligence, misrepresentations/omissions, failure to supervise, and breach of contract.
